Статистика
Всего в нашей базе более 4 327 663 вопросов и 6 445 976 ответов!

Из заданного числа вычли сумму его цифр. Из результата вновь вычли сумму его цифр и т.д. сколько таких действий надо произвести, чтобы получился нуль.

10-11 класс

Помогите пожалуйста. Принцип работы должен быть такой: берем число, например 24, считаем сумму его цифр 2+4=6 =>вычитаем 24-6=18 => 1+8=9 => 18-9 => 9-9=0

Alin16 10 окт. 2015 г., 6:40:18 (8 лет назад)
Рейтинг
+ 0 -
0 Жалоба
+ 0 -
1337Den4ik1337
10 окт. 2015 г., 7:50:20 (8 лет назад)

 Pascal
//Эта программа корректно работает для двухзнаных чисел
// при a > 100 будет к примеру 125 =>125-(12+5)...

var   a,k : integer; 
    begin 
  k := 0; 
 readln (a); 
 while a > 0 do 
 begin 
  a := a - (a div 10 + a mod 10); 
 k := k +1; 
  end; 
writeln (k); 
end.

Ответить

Другие вопросы из категории

В коробке лежат 64 карандаша: красные, синие,

зеленые. Сообщение о том, что достали два карандаша – красный и синий, несет 9
бит информации. Сообщение о том, что достали красный карандаш, несет 5 бит
информации. Сколько было зеленых карандашей?

Читайте также

1.Дано двузначное число.Определить: a.какая из его цифр больше,первая или вторая; b. одинаковы ли его цифры. 2. Дано двухзначное число.

Определить,равен ли квадрат этого числа учетверённой сумме кубов его цифр. Например, для числа 48 ответ положительный, для числа 52-отрицательный. 3. Дано двузначное число. Определить: a. кратна ли трём сумма его цифр b. кратна ли сумма его цифр числу a. 4. Дано трёхзначное число Определить,равен ли квадрат этого числа сумме кубов его цифр. 5. Дано двузначное число,определить:входит ли в него цифра 3: входит ли в него цифра a.

Дано натуральное число: определить а) количество цифр в нем б)сумму его цифр в)произведение его цифр г)среднее арифметическое его цифр

д)сумму квадратов его цифр е)сумму кубов его цифр ж)его первую цифру з)сумму его первой и последней цифр

Игрок А объявляет двузначное число от 01 до 99. Игрок В меняет местами его цифры и прибавляет полученное число к сумме его цифр. Полученный результат он

объявляет игроку А. Игрок А проделывает с этим числом ту же процедуру, и так они продолжают поступать поочередно, объявляя числа. От суммы чисел берется остаток от деления на 100, поэтому объявляются лишь двузначные числа. Какие числа может объявить игрок А на начальном шаге, чтобы игрок В в некоторый момент объявил число 00.



Вы находитесь на странице вопроса "Из заданного числа вычли сумму его цифр. Из результата вновь вычли сумму его цифр и т.д. сколько таких действий надо произвести, чтобы получился нуль.", категории "информатика". Данный вопрос относится к разделу "10-11" классов. Здесь вы сможете получить ответ, а также обсудить вопрос с посетителями сайта. Автоматический умный поиск поможет найти похожие вопросы в категории "информатика". Если ваш вопрос отличается или ответы не подходят, вы можете задать новый вопрос, воспользовавшись кнопкой в верхней части сайта.